Installation guide
3. In the “Language Selecon Page”, select the language or languages for your CRS installaon. Click “Next”.
4. In the “Cluster Conguraon Page”, enter a globally unique cluster name. Do not use special characters such as (, ), !, @,
#, %, ^, &, and *. Also enter a public and a private node name for each node, without any domain qualiers. Use the primary
and private entered in the hosts le in an earlier step. Click “Next”.
5. In the “Private Interconnect Enforcement” page, a list is displayed of all of the cluster network interfaces. For each
interface, you must choose “Public”, “Private”, or “Do Not Use” from the drop-down menus. The default seng for each
interface is “Do Not Use”. You are required to classify at least one interconnect as Public and one as Private.
6. The “Select Disk Formang Opons Page” is used to indicate what logical drives (if any) will be formaed for OCFS. There
are several dierent opons:
a. Format two logical drives for data and soware storage. Choosing this opon creates two cluster le systems,
one for the database les and one for a shared Oracle Home. The OCR and vong disk are created on the cluster
le system for data les.
b. Format one logical drive for soware storage. In this case, a shared Oracle Home is created. You could use this
opon if you wished to place the Oracle Home on OCFS, and the data les on ASM storage. You would also be
required to provide two extra logical parons, one for the OCR and one for the vong disk. The method for
creang logical drives is listed above. These parons will be stamped with “ocrcfg” for the OCR and “votedsk”
for the vong disk.
c. Format one logical drive for data le storage. In this case, one cluster le system for the database les is created.
The OCR and vong disk are also stored on the cluster le system.
Aer choosing an opon, click Next to move to the next page.
7. The next few pages that are displayed depend on the opon you chose on the “Select Disk Formang Opons” page. All
subsequent pages are listed below:
a. The “Select Soware Storage Drive” page is displayed if you selected the “Format two logical drives for data and
soware storage” opon or the “Format one logical drive for soware storage” opon. Choose a shared drive from
the list, then choose a paron from the next list with enough space to contain all Oracle soware. Click next to
connue.
b. The “Select Data Storage Drive” page is displayed if you selected the “Format two logical drives for data and so
ware storage” opon or the “Format one logical drive for data le storage” opon. Choose a shared drive from the
list, then choose a paron from the next list with enough space to contain all of the Oracle database les. Click
Next to connue.
c. The “Disk Conguraon – Oracle Cluster Registry (OCR)” page is displayed if you selected the “Format one logical
drive for soware storage” opon or the “Do not format any logical drives” opon. Choose a paron from the list
with enough space to contain the OCR. Click Next to connue.
d. The “Disk Conguraon – Vong Disk” page is displayed if you selected the “Format one logical drive for
soware storage” opon or the “Do not format any logical drives” opon. Choose a paron from the list with
enough space to contain the Vong Disk. Click Next to connue.
8. Aer you click Next, the OUI sets up remote registry inventories by seng registry keys, if not already done. Write
permissions on the remote registries are also checked. Aer successful compleon of these steps, a Summary page is
displayed that shows cluster node informaon and space requirements and availability. Aer you have veried the planned
installaon, then click Finish.
9. The installaon proceeds with the installaon of OCFS and creaon of any required OCFS le systems. In addion,
CRS soware is also installed on the local node. Aer the installaon is validated on the rst node, the OUI completes the
installaon of CRS soware on the remote nodes.
